One of the buildings in the Grand Palace complex.
Shot the building as a silhouette to get the blue colours in the sky (-3 stops under exposed). While processing I thought it would be nice to have the building also exposed. So, adjusted the levels to bring the details on the buildings. Then added the sky from the original image. My selection of the sky was not very good. You can still see the edges around the building.
